Harmic Acid Methyl Ester
| Internal ID | 74a25931-1522-4be5-962c-fd9429535d60 |
| Taxonomy | Alkaloids and derivatives > Harmala alkaloids |
| IUPAC Name | methyl 7-methoxy-9H-pyrido[3,4-b]indole-1-carboxylate |
| SMILES (Canonical) | |
| SMILES (Isomeric) | |
| InChI | InChI=1S/C14H12N2O3/c1-18-8-3-4-9-10-5-6-15-13(14(17)19-2)12(10)16-11(9)7-8/h3-7,16H,1-2H3 |
| InChI Key | GGTFWDPYRXONGD-UHFFFAOYSA-N |
| Popularity | 4 references in papers |
| Molecular Formula | C14H12N2O3 |
| Molecular Weight | 256.26 g/mol |
| Exact Mass | 256.08479225 g/mol |
| Topological Polar Surface Area (TPSA) | 64.20 Ų |
| XlogP | 2.50 |
